    JOB SUMMARY: The basic function of the Registrar is to efficiently process all patients according to the standards established by the organization.

    SCHEDULE: FT, 38.75 hours per week

    Week 1: WED 7:30AM - 7:30PM, THU 8:00AM - 7:00PM, FRI 8:00AM - 7:00PM, SAT 8:45AM - 3:00PM

    Week 2: SUN 8:45AM - 3:00PM, WED 7:30AM - 7:30PM, THU 8:00AM - 7:00PM, FRI 8:00AM - 7:00PM

    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Greets patients/visitors in a professional, courteous and helpful manner.

    • Registers patients for his/her scheduled visit with the provider.

    • Ensures all demographic, insurance information, and required forms are gathered and entered into medical record for all patient visits.

    • Scans patient identification and patient insurance card/cards and verifies benefits and eligibility information.

    • Verifies managed care referrals are on file when necessary, per insurance requirements.

    • Collects copays and outstanding balances from patients.

    • Answers telephones promptly, identifies self and directs calls as appropriate.

    • Provides coverage for other Registrars during absences.

    • Travels to other offices when there is an organizational need to provide coverage for the schedules.

    • Maintains a positive and professional attitude towards patients, co-workers and physicians.

    • Keeps work area orderly and neat.

    • Demonstrates flexibility in performing additional responsibilities that contribute to the improvement of patient care and the well-being of the Practice.

    • Handles difficult situations tactfully.

    • Reviews and issues work and/or school notes.

    • Schedules appointments as instructed by provider team in E-superbill.

    • Reconciles daily payments.
